Former England speedster Steve Harmison has compared Indian fast bowling sensation Jasprit Bumrah to football legend Cristiano Ronaldo.
According to Harmison, Bumrah missing the ICC Champions Trophy 2025, would be like a football World Cup without Cristiano Ronaldo.
“He’s Jasprit Bumrah. For me, you can’t replace Jasprit Bumrah anytime. And I mean, I would even go up to the morning of the final to take him that far because he’s Jasprit Bumrah,” said Harmison during a recent interaction.
“Bumrah is the best in the world, and from an Indian perspective, that’s how we see it. It’s like going to a football World Cup with your star striker, Cristiano Ronaldo. Fifteen years ago, you didn’t replace Ronaldo unless you absolutely had to, and I believe India will approach Bumrah in a similar way,” he further said.

Notably, in a massive setback to India, Bumrah has been ruled out of the upcoming ICC Champions Trophy 2025 due to a lower back injury.
The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) confirmed on Tuesday night that Bumrah, who sustained the injury during the final Test against Australia in Sydney, has not regained full fitness in time for the tournament. Bumrah will be replaced by young pacer Harshit Rana in the squad.
